Crash at Airline Drive early Sunday; 9 incidents in 30 days

August 16, 2026 at 06:54 AMBy Dennis R. Mundy, Executive Editor📍 Harris County

A major crash shut down 6600 Airline Drive early Sunday morning at 6:54 AM, adding to a mounting pattern of collisions at this residential location.

Responding officers cleared the scene, but the incident underscores ongoing crash activity in the area. According to LocalTrafficAccidents.com data, the corridor has logged 9 incidents in the past 30 days, with 4 classified as major—the same severity level as Sunday's wreck. Over the past 12 months, the location has recorded 11 total incidents, 5 of them major.

Looking at a longer timeframe, state crash records from the Texas Department of Transportation show 49 crashes within about a quarter-mile of this address since January 2020, with no fatalities recorded. Contributing factors as recorded by the investigating officer, per TxDOT CRIS, show "Failed To Yield Right Of Way - Stop Sign" as the leading factor, cited in 12 crashes at this corridor.

Conditions at the time of the crash were clear, with temperatures around 79 degrees. While weather wasn't a factor Sunday morning, wet pavement has been a documented contributing factor in crashes across Texas—TxDOT reports that adverse conditions contribute to thousands of crashes annually statewide.

Harris County overall saw 17,973 incidents in the past 30 days, including 14 fatalities. The Airline Drive location, while residential, continues to draw attention from drivers and first responders navigating the intersection.

No additional details about injuries or vehicle counts were available at the time of reporting. The road has since reopened to normal traffic flow.
